Getting started with e3¶
The ESS EPICS environment (e3) uses conda for environment and package management and explicitly builds on conda-forge: we follow conda-forge’s global pinning file and use their repodata for dependency resolution. ESS site-specific packages (typically EPICS modules) are hosted on an internal conda channel in our Artifactory.

Configuring conda¶
Configure your machine to find packages in the ESS conda channel:
$ conda config --prepend channels ess-conda-local
$ conda config --set channel_alias https://artifactory.esss.lu.se/artifactory/api/conda
$ conda config --set channel_priority strict
Note
Your configuration is stored at ~/.condarc. After the commands above, it will look
like:
channels:
- ess-conda-local
- conda-forge
channel_alias: https://artifactory.esss.lu.se/artifactory/api/conda
channel_priority: strict
Important
Keep the channel order exactly as shown and use channel_priority: strict. This
ensures that ESS packages get prioritised and avoids environment conflicts.
Caution
It is important to not mix Anaconda channels with conda-forge as the two are incompatible.
See Transitioning from Anaconda’s default channels
for more information.
Creating an e3 (conda) environment¶
Conda manages virtual environments; you control their contents.
To create an environment containing EPICS base and require:
$ conda create --name=e3 epics-base require
This tells conda to create an environment named e3 with EPICS base, require,
and all dependencies.
You can verify the environment was created successfully:
$ conda info --envs
# conda environments:
#
base * /home/johndoe/miniforge3
e3 /home/johndoe/miniforge3/envs/e3
Using conda environments¶
Once you have created an environment, activate it with:
$ conda activate e3
You can deactivate the currently active environment with:
(e3) $ conda deactivate

Installing an e3 module
Install e3 modules like any other conda package. To add the iocStats
module, install its e3 conda package iocstats (conda package names are lowercase only).
From within an activated environment:
(e3) $ conda install iocstats
Or specify the environment explicitly with --name:
$ conda install --name=e3 iocstats
